Understanding WiFi Speed Issues on Windows 11
Before diving into solutions, it’s crucial to understand the factors that affect your laptop’s WiFi connectivity. WiFi speed can be influenced by a variety of elements:
1. Distance from Router
One of the most common issues affecting WiFi speed is the physical distance between your laptop and the router. The further you are, the weaker the signal becomes.
2. Interference
Other electronic devices, especially microwaves and Bluetooth devices, can interfere with WiFi signals, leading to reduced speeds.
3. Bandwidth Congestion
If multiple devices are connected to the same network and using significant bandwidth, it can slow down the connection for all devices.
4. Outdated Network Drivers
Old or incompatible network drivers can result in connectivity issues, adversely affecting WiFi performance.
Tips to Increase WiFi Speed on Your Windows 11 Laptop
Now that we’ve established the underlying issues, let’s explore some actionable strategies to enhance your WiFi speed on Windows 11.
1. Change Your WiFi Frequency Band
Modern routers often operate on two bands: 2.4GHz and 5GHz. Here’s how to switch between them:
- 2.4GHz: This band covers a wider area but generally offers slower speeds and is more susceptible to interference.
- 5GHz: This band offers faster speeds over shorter distances and is less prone to interference.

2. Optimize Router Placement
The placement of your router plays a critical role in determining the quality of your internet connection. Here are some tips for optimal router placement:
- Elevate the Router: Place your router on a shelf or another high surface.
- Central Location: Position the router in a central location within your home for improved coverage.
- Avoid Obstacles: Keep the router away from walls, furniture, and large appliances that might block the signal.

4. Update Network Drivers
Keeping your network drivers up to date ensures optimal performance. Here’s how to update them:
- Right-click on the Start Menu and select Device Manager.
- Expand the Network adapters section.
- Right-click on your WiFi adapter and select Update driver.
- Choose Search automatically for updated driver software.

6. Disable Power Saving Mode
Windows 11 can automatically switch your laptop to power-saving mode, affecting WiFi performance. To disable it:
- Go to Settings > System > Power & battery.
- Click on Additional power settings under Related settings.
- Select Change plan settings for your active plan.
- Click on Change advanced power settings and expand the Wireless Adapter Settings.
- Set Power Saving Mode to Maximum Performance for both plugged in and battery settings.

Advanced Techniques to Boost WiFi Performance
If basic troubleshooting doesn’t yield the desired results, you may want to explore more advanced strategies.
1. Upgrade Your Router
If your router is outdated, it may not support the latest WiFi standards (e.g., WiFi 5 (802.11ac) or WiFi 6 (802.11ax)). Consider upgrading to a newer model that can provide better coverage and higher speeds.
2. Use WiFi Extenders
WiFi extenders can help improve coverage in larger homes. They pick up the router’s signal and amplify it, providing better coverage in dead zones.
3. Enable QoS in Your Router
Quality of Service (QoS) allows you to manage bandwidth allocation for different applications on your network. By prioritizing high-traffic applications, you can ensure they receive the necessary bandwidth for smooth operation.
4. Reset Network Settings
As a last resort, you can reset your network settings to restore everything to its default state. To do this:
- Go to Settings > Network & Internet.
- Scroll down and click on Advanced network settings.
- Under More settings, select Network reset.
- Follow the prompts to complete the reset process.
Monitor Your Internet Speed
After making changes to optimize your WiFi speed, it’s important to monitor the speed to gauge effectiveness. Several free online tools such as Speedtest by Ookla or Fast.com can help you measure your connection speed conveniently.

What factors affect my WiFi speed on a Windows 11 laptop?
The speed of your WiFi on a Windows 11 laptop can be influenced by several factors. First, the distance from your router plays a crucial role; the further away you are, the weaker the signal will be, resulting in slower speeds. Physical obstructions like walls, floors, and furniture can also interfere with the WiFi signal, especially if they are made of materials such as concrete or metal. Additionally, interference from other electronic devices like microwaves and cordless phones can impact signal quality and speed.
Another important aspect is the capabilities of your laptop’s WiFi adapter. Older devices may not support newer WiFi standards like Wi-Fi 6, which allows faster and more efficient data transmission. Network congestion can also be a factor, particularly in crowded environments where multiple devices are vying for bandwidth. Finally, your Internet Service Provider (ISP) plan’s speed will set a baseline for your WiFi performance.

Does using a VPN affect my WiFi speed?
Yes, using a VPN can affect your WiFi speed. When you connect to a VPN, your internet traffic is routed through a server, which adds an extra step in the data transmission process. This can lead to increased latency and slower speeds, especially if the VPN server is located far from your physical location or if it is overloaded with users. Depending on the type of encryption and the VPN protocol in use, there may also be additional latency that impacts performance.
That said, some high-quality VPN services employ faster servers and advanced protocols that can mitigate speed loss. If you notice significant slowdowns while using a VPN, you may want to try switching to a different server within the app, preferably one closer to your geographical region. Additionally, if speed is a major concern, consider temporarily disconnecting from the VPN while performing bandwidth-intensive tasks.
What hardware upgrades should I consider for better WiFi performance?
If you’ve exhausted software settings and other improvements without satisfactory results, hardware upgrades may be necessary to enhance WiFi performance. One of the most effective upgrades is to replace your old router with a newer model that supports the latest WiFi standards, like Wi-Fi 6 or Wi-Fi 6E. These newer routers offer improved speed, capacity, and better performance in congested areas, making them a worthwhile investment.
Another hardware consideration is upgrading your laptop’s WiFi adapter, especially if it is older. Many laptops allow for the installation of a modern WiFi card that supports better frequencies and faster standards. If your router does not support the latest technology, consider simultaneously upgrading both the router and the adapter for the best results. Finally, adding external antennas or using high-gain antennas can help boost the signal quality and range significantly.
